The Biggest Mistake Networkers Make!
First, let's define who you follow up with. I'm not talking about continuously
contacting friends and family who have told you they're not interested.
Follow up is done with people who have expressed interest in your product/
service or business. Many miss opportunities to grow their business by not
following up on legitimate prospects.
While you don’t want to hassle people, most prospects aren’t going to sign
up on the first call. Sometimes the timing isn’t right. Or maybe they need to
think about it or do their research.
You should Have a system for following up with prospects.
For example, after the presentation, if the person isn’t ready, make an
appointment to call back in a few days. If they are not interested, ask if you
can add them to your email list (be sure to send helpful information and tips,
not just “join me” emails).
Here is an important Hint...If people are adamant that they are not interested,
let it go!!!
They may come around once they see your success or maybe they never will.
But you don’t want to hurt your relationships by constantly trying to recruit
people who are not interested.
Follow up is a very vital part of your business, do not ignore it.
